Succession Planning: Preparing for the Future of Your Facility and Your Career

 

monograph (cover)
by Ed Avis

This monograph shows health care facility managers how to conduct succession planning for their departments and shows individuals in all positions how to develop a path for personal career development. The monograph shows readers how to:

  • Identify key positions that required succession planning strategies
  • Define the competencies required for the identified positions through accurate position summaries
  • Assess current employee competencies for key positions
  • Identify and develop internal resources to fill gaps in education and experience
  • Cultivate external resources and relationships to fill key facility positions
  • Plan for personal career growth
